Australian cultivated meat producer Magic Valley recently conducted an exclusive tasting of its lamb meatballs and pork dumplings at the Parliament of New South Wales, with Members of Parliament and government officials among the guests. The event received positive feedback, with attendees praising the guilt-free nature of cultivated meat and its potential to change the world by eliminating animal cruelty, deforestation, and reducing water and CO2 emissions.
Magic Valley is now raising capital to construct its first manufacturing facility in Australia, with support from the Federal Government and potential funding through the Industry Growth Program. The company aims to position Australia as a leader in the production and export of cellular agriculture, creating jobs, advancing technology, and participating in the rapidly growing industry of cultivated meat production. With government and private investors on board, Magic Valley is set to build advanced facilities, create regional employment opportunities, and export high-tech protein to the global market.
